#b67dce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b67dce is composed of 71.4% red, 49%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 11.7% cyan, 39.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 282.2 degrees, a saturation of 45.3% and a lightness of 64.9%. #b67dce color hex could be obtained by blending #fffaff with #6d009d.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

● #b67dce color description : Slightly desaturated violet.
#b67dce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b67dce has RGB values of R:182, G:125, B:206 and CMYK values of C:0.12, M:0.39, Y:0,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 11959758.
